Life can feel like a rollercoaster, a constant barrage of pressure. Our thoughts race, consumed by fears. We fall in the vicious cycle, unable to escape. But there is freedom to be found. By embracing our stress, we can begin to manage its hold over us.

It starts with paying attention. Notice the physical symptoms of anxiety—the racing heart, the shallow gasps, the tightness in your chest. Next, challenge your thoughts. Are they based on facts? Often, our is born from distorted thinking patterns.

By cultivating mindfulness, we can train ourselves to observe our thoughts without reactivity. We can build a space of calm within ourselves, even amidst the chaos.

Hormones, Stress, and You: Understanding Women's Mental Health

Women's mental health can be a unique set of challenges. Variable hormone levels throughout life can greatly impact mood, energy, and thinking clarity. Stress, whether from work, relationships, or routine life, can further worsen these hormonal shifts, leading to a pattern of emotional distress.

  • Understanding how hormones and stress influence in women's mental health is crucial for seeking appropriate treatment.
  • By learning about the connection between these factors, women can better manage the challenges they experience.
